Sunderland veteran Dwight Yorke has admitted he is not sure where his future lies. The midfielder's contract is expiring in the summer, and the 36 year old has indicated that he feels he has more left in the tank.

"Who knows what is in store for me next year?" he told the Sunderland Echo.

"My contract runs out at the end of the season and I will have to sit and see what happens. Will there be an offer for me? I don't know.

"In the meantime, I have just got to keep trying to do my best for Sunderland Football Club until the end of the season.

"If I didn't think I could be playing then I would happily walk away from the game today.

"I feel I can play in this position I'm playing today and I feel I can compete with some of the young lads still.

"I'll keep going until the moment comes when I can't help the team or contribute to the team in any way, then I will certainly walk away.

"Right now I'm still enjoying the game, even though I would like to win a few more matches, which would make it a lot easier for all of us."
